    Channing Tatum up for Contortionist's Handbook

    John Cena...er, I mean Channing Tatum is set for the lead role in an adaptation of Craig Clevenger's novel The Contortionists Handbook.

    The main character John Vincent is born deformed with a sixth finger which leads to an interest in prestidigitation. As he grows older he becomes very cunning with crimes and new identities having to move from place to place based on a strict code of conduct preventing him from getting caught. He meets a woman with her own problems who of course screws everything up.

    The image from the book looks interesting and the descriptions of the story have me intriguied with this project. I'm not familiar with many of Tatum's roles, but wasn't impressed with him in Step Up and he didn't have enough screen time in Public Enemies for me to formulate a good opinion. I've read favorable comments on his role in Dear John though and will not pass judgement until he has more films on his resume.

    I am looking forward to this one and if he performs well then thats all the better for him.
